Analysis

The most recent figure for age of electoral democracy lexical in Mexico is 26, measured in 2025. That is the highest value across all 26 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 4.0% on the previous year and up 62.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, age of electoral democracy lexical in Mexico peaked at 26 in 2025 and was at its lowest, 1, in 2000.

Mexico ranks 97th of 144 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
